Standard Features
The three phase pad mounted transformer immerses the load switch and fuse on the high voltage side of the transformer with the core and windings of the transformer in the same oil tank, has the advantages of advanced structure, reliable performance, energy saving and consumption reduction, flexible use, strong adaptability, and economical advantages.

Advantages of Pad Mounted Transformer
1. Space-Saving Design
Pad-mounted transformers feature a compact, high-efficiency design, making them an ideal choice for locations with limited available space. They eliminate the need for additional supporting structures such as utility poles or dedicated buildings during installation.
2. Enhanced Safety Standards
Pad-mounted transformers are engineered with tamper-proof and robust security features. Housed in a durable metal enclosure, they completely eliminate the risk of accidental contact with live electrical components.
3. Superior Aesthetics
Pad-mounted transformers typically integrate seamlessly with their surrounding environment, positioning them as a more suitable option for residential communities and areas subject to strict zoning regulations.
